I was originally drawn to the GUE fundamentals course due to its world famous reputation for developing key skills around buoyancy, trim, stability and team awareness.
The fundamentals course with Bartek was fantastic. Whilst the course was challenging, at no point was it overwhelming, as the structure of the course is such that your comfort zone, and also your capacity as a diver, is gradually pushed and extended day by day.
I remember a bizarre moment from day four, where I was back-kicking towards my teammate’s SMB line to keep position, whilst on another teammate’s long hose during an Out of Gas simulation. If you’d told me I’d have been doing that a few days earlier I would never have believed you.
Bartek as an instructor has a great knack for tailoring feedback to each student’s needs. Whilst I appreciate direct, to the point feedback, I could see him adjusting his delivery style to the other teammate’s preferences.
You read a lot online about how fundamentals is this “transformative” course. I wondered if perhaps that claim was over exaggerated by previous students, however I can assure you that its reputation is more than deserved

I did the Performance Diver training with Bartek Trzciński in February 2025 and in my opinion it was the best course I have been on so far. It seems like only two days, but the combination of intensive practice (both dry and underwater) with theory (online) really changed a lot when it comes to my skills. Back-kick? Basic 5 when hovering in neutral buoyancy? OOG + surfacing? No problem! For me, this course opened the gate to further adventure with GUE and I am already planning further training under Bartek’s supervision.
